参数资料
型号: TSC8051C1XXX-12IDD
元件分类: 8位微控制器
英文描述: 8-Bit Microcontroller for Digital Computer Monitors
中文描述: 8位数字的电脑显示器微控制器
文件页数: 11/31页
文件大小: 321K
代理商: TSC8051C1XXX-12IDD
TSC8051C1
Rev. D (14 Jan. 97)
19
MATRA MHS
Figure 15. shows a typical use of I2C bus with SIO1, and
Figure 16. shows a complete data transfer with SIO1.
Rp
SCL/P3.6
SDA/P3.7
TSC8051C1
Device
2
Device
N
Device
1
Rp
Figure 15. Typical I2C bus configuration
R/W
direction
Acknowledgment
signal from receiver
MSB
SCL
SDA
S
P/S
Acknowledgment
signal from receiver
Slave Address
Nth data byte
Clock line held low while interrupts are serviced
12
8
9
bit
12
8
9
Figure 16. Complete data transfer on I2C bus
Three 8–bit special function registers are used to control
SIO1: the control register (S1CON SFR), the status
register (S1STA SFR) and the data register (S1DAT
SFR).
S1CON is used to enable SIO1, to program the bit rate
(see Table 6. ), to acknowledge or not a received data, to
send a start or a stop condition on the I2C bus, and to
acknowledge a serial interrupt.
S1CON: Synchronous Serial Control Register
MSB
SFR D8h
LSB
CR2
ENS1
STA
STO
SI
AA
CR1
CR0
Symbol
Position
Name and Function
CR0
S1CON.0
Control Rate bit 0. See Table 6.
CR1
S1CON.1
Control Rate bit 1. See Table 6.
AA
S1CON.2
Assert Acknowledge flag. In receiver mode, setting this bit forces an acknowledge
(low level on SDA). In receiver mode, clearing this bit forces a not acknowledge
(high level on SDA). When in transmitter mode, this bit has no effect.
SI
S1CON.3
Synchronous Serial Interrupt flag. This bit is set by hardware when a serial interrupt
is requested. This bit must be reset by software to acknowledge interrupt.
ST0
S1CON.4
Stop flag. Setting this bit causes a stop condition to be sent on bus.
STA
S1CON.5
Start flag. Setting this bit causes a start condition to be sent on bus.
ENS1
S1CON.6
Synchronous Serial Enable bit. Setting this bit enables the SIO1 controller.
CR2
S1CON.7
Control Rate bit 2. See Table 6.
S1CON is a read/write. Its value after reset is 00h which
disables the I2C controller.
S1CON is using TSC8051C1 Special Function Register
address, D8h.
相关PDF资料
PDF描述
TSC8051C1XXX-12IDR 8-Bit Microcontroller for Digital Computer Monitors
TSC8051C1XXX-16CAR 8-Bit Microcontroller for Digital Computer Monitors
TSC8051C1XXX-16CBR 8-Bit Microcontroller for Digital Computer Monitors
TSC8051C1XXX-16CEB 8-Bit Microcontroller for Digital Computer Monitors
TSC8051C1XXX-16CED 8-Bit Microcontroller for Digital Computer Monitors
相关代理商/技术参数
参数描述
TSC8051C1XXX-12IDR 制造商:TEMIC 制造商全称:TEMIC Semiconductors 功能描述:8-Bit Microcontroller for Digital Computer Monitors
TSC8051C1XXX-12IEB 制造商:TEMIC 制造商全称:TEMIC Semiconductors 功能描述:8-Bit Microcontroller for Digital Computer Monitors
TSC8051C1XXX-12IED 制造商:TEMIC 制造商全称:TEMIC Semiconductors 功能描述:8-Bit Microcontroller for Digital Computer Monitors
TSC8051C1XXX-12IER 制造商:TEMIC 制造商全称:TEMIC Semiconductors 功能描述:8-Bit Microcontroller for Digital Computer Monitors
TSC8051C1XXX-12IGB 制造商:TEMIC 制造商全称:TEMIC Semiconductors 功能描述:8-Bit Microcontroller for Digital Computer Monitors